ALMANZA AVENDANO, Ariagor Manuel  and  GOMEZ SAN LUIS, Anel Hortensia. An approach to clients of prostitution in Mexico. Andamios [online]. 2021, vol.18, n.45, pp.435-455.  Epub Sep 27, 2021. ISSN 2594-1917.  https://doi.org/10.29092/uacm.v18i45.825.

The present study makes a literature search of clients for prostitution in Mexico, first in socio-demographic terms; later, in the field of subjectivity, through their motivations to attend prostitution, considering the typologies developed by various authors. Subsequently, the approximation is performed by a historical tour of prostitution in Mexico, through which it is possible to track client engagement and relationship with the State. Finally, a reflection on client engagement in prostitution takes place, at a time marked by the expansion of trafficking for commercial sexual exploitation.

Keywords : Clients; prostitution; trafficking; sexual exploitation; masculinities.
